What are the dimension and mechanical specifications of the 1972 Porsche 917/10?
Q: What is the wheelbase size of the 1972 Porsche 917/10? A: The 1972 Porsche 917/10 has a wheelbase size of 91.20 inches.Q: What is the length of the 1972 Porsche 917/10? A: The 1972 Porsche 917/10 has a length of 147.20 inches.Q: What is the width of the 1972 Porsche 917/10? A: The 1972 Porsche 917/10 has a width of 81.89 inches.Q: What is the bodystyle of the 1972 Porsche 917/10? A: The 1972 Porsche 917/10 was a Racing Spyder.Q: How many vehicles did Porsche produce in 1972? A: Porsche produced 20,464 automobiles in 1972.Q: How many 917/10 were produced? A: Porsche produced 13 examples of the 917/10 from 1972 to 1972.Q: What engine did the 1972 Porsche 917/10 have? A: The engine powering the 1972 Porsche 917/10 was a Twin-turbocharged Flat 12 (4494 cc | 274.2 cu in. | 4.5 L.) with 1,000 BHP (736 KW) @ 7800 RPM and 686 Ft-Lbs (930 NM) @ 4600 RPM. Q: What transmissions did the 1972 Porsche 917/10 have? A: The 1972 Porsche 917/10 had the following gearbox options: 4 speed Manual, 4 speed CVT.
